Opinion Essay

Question: There is nothing that young people can teach old people.

To which extent do you agree or disagree with the statement.

Word count: Write at least 250 words.

Less – you didn’t elaborate enough

Over 320 – beating round the bush/didn’t choose the right words

Sweet spot – 280 words

The opinion essay has a subjective tone and isn’t balanced at all as demonstrated in the structure for
the main body. You achieve that by using the phrases below. You shouldn’t overdo it, using them 3 or
4 times will be enough.

You have two options for the introduction, a short version or a long one. The short one is on point and
leaves more room for more sentences in the main body. The long one puts the topic into context and
gives way to more variety in terms of grammar and vocabulary. The paraphrase is a sentence where
you retell the question with synonyms – different words, same meaning. The thesis sentence is the
one that connects the introduction to the main body and announces to the reader what to expect.

Short introduction 40 words

- Paraphrase Most people believe that the youth cannot teach the elderly about anything in
the world.
- Thesis sentence I strongly disagree with that idea mostly because of the influence
they could have in two major topics, the technological advances and the
social changes taking place at the moment.

Long introduction 65/70

- General sentence The world has changed drastically in the last 50 years as a result of the
progressive ideas in science and social sciences.
- Specific sentence People who were used to a different, simple lifestyle are struggling to keep pace
with the modern way of living.
- Paraphrase Most people believe that the youth cannot teach the elderly about anything in
the world.
- Thesis sentence I strongly disagree with that idea mostly because of the influence
they could have in two major topics, the technological advances and the
social changes taking place at the moment.

Main Body

Ideally you should write 2 well elaborated paragraphs leaning only on one side, you either agree or
disagree in both of them. However, you can write an optional third paragraph focused on the other
side if you’re below the word count. Try to avoid it.
